**Alert: ScanBridge decode failures above threshold**

Heads up, support folks — this fires when the ScanBridge barcode integration rejects more than 5% of scans over ten minutes. Usually it's a firmware mismatch on the Fennwick handheld units, not a backend issue, so don't escalate to platform right away. Ask the customer which scanner model they're on and whether they updated recently. Triage steps, known-bad firmware versions, and the escalation path are all kept on the internal runbook page.

wiki page, tahaf-tajog: https://jira.ordindyn.corp/pipeline

Handover note — Crumbwheel order cutoffs.

Welcome aboard. The bakery cutoff rule in Crumbwheel closes same-day orders at 14:00 local to each storefront, not UTC — this has bitten us twice. Holiday overrides live in the calendar service and take precedence silently, so always check there first when a cutoff looks wrong. To unlock the calendar service's admin console after a restart, enter the recovery passphrase below.

vault phrase of bagap-bahaf = silion-pelox-sorox-casdor-quenwyn-fraax-eliox-praael-kelion-quenvan-kasox-rusael-norius-belvan

The `strex` translation-string extraction script fails in CI because the Oakmire secrets vault auto-locked after three bad unlock attempts by the old service account. Reviewer: please confirm the updated script no longer embeds vault calls in the parse loop; extraction itself needs no secrets. Until the fix merges, the nightly job still requires a manual unlock by whoever is on rotation. Per team convention for stopgap unlocks, the vault passphrase is recorded at the bottom of this ticket.

strongbox words: gilok-druion-briath-wendor-briion-prawyn-fenion-oliir-casdor-holius-briius-gilath-gilael-pelys

**Temporary Site — Harwick Annex**

During the Pellview Tower renovation, facilities desk operates from the Harwick Annex, Level 2. Hours unchanged. Route all contractor queries to the annex counter. Keycard readers at the annex use the interim access profile; standard badges will not scan until re-enrolled. Until then, use the temporary pass code below at the annex door.

turnstile pass: bdg-JBCWS-7